The Significance of Localized User Interfaces
Localization extends beyond mere translation; it encompasses adapting visual elements, date and currency formats, and even betting terminologies to resonate with regional user preferences. A well-localized interface not only offers better usability but also signals acknowledgment and respect for players’ cultural backgrounds, fostering loyalty and positive brand perception.
Designing for Multilingual Users
Developing an effective multilingual interface requires meticulous planning, including the integration of reliable translation management systems and user-friendly language selection mechanisms. Developers often implement flag-based selectors, dropdown menus, or speech recognition tools to facilitate seamless language switching. Furthermore, considering accessibility features such as screen reader compatibility and adjustable font sizes is crucial for reaching a broader user demographic.

Technical Challenges and Best Practices
- Maintaining Language Consistency: Regular updates and quality assurance processes are necessary to keep translations accurate and contextually relevant.
- Handling Cultural Nuances: Beyond language, cultural sensitivities must be respected, avoiding idiomatic expressions or imagery that may be misinterpreted.
- Optimizing for SEO: Proper markup and localized content help in reaching targeted regional audiences effectively.
